We derive recurrence relations for leading logarithmic all-loop quantum corrections in the case of SO(N) symmetric scalar theory with an arbitrary potential in curved spacetime. On this basis, a system of renormalisation group (RG) equations in the general is obtained approach for the effective potential in the large N limit. As a simple illustration, we analyse the case of power-like potentials in the Jordan frame and discuss their application to inflationary cosmology.
